as per the specification
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"as per the specification" is correct and usable in written English.
It is typically used to indicate that something is being done according to specific guidelines or requirements outlined in a specification document. Example: "The product was manufactured as per the specification provided by the client."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When using "as per the specification", ensure that the specification document is clearly referenced or accessible to the relevant parties to avoid ambiguity.
Common error
Avoid using "as per the specification" without providing context or access to the specification document. This can lead to confusion and misinterpretation of requirements.

Linguistic Context
The phrase "as per the specification" functions as a prepositional phrase, modifying a verb or noun by indicating that an action or attribute is in accordance with a defined specification. As Ludwig AI confirms, it is grammatically sound.

More alternative expressions(6)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
according to the specification
This alternative is more direct and commonly used in technical contexts.
in accordance with the specification
This alternative is more formal and emphasizes compliance.
following the specification
This alternative highlights the act of adhering to the specification.
as stipulated in the specification
This alternative emphasizes that the specification is a binding agreement.
in line with the specification
This alternative suggests alignment and agreement with the specification.
consistent with the specification
This alternative focuses on maintaining uniformity with the specification.
pursuant to the specification
This alternative is a formal and legalistic way of saying 'according to'.
under the terms of the specification
This alternative emphasizes the contractual nature of the specification.
as detailed in the specification
This alternative highlights that the specification contains specific details.
conforming to the specification
This alternative stresses the act of meeting the requirements of the specification.
FAQs
What does "as per the specification" mean?
The phrase "as per the specification" means "according to the details outlined in the specification document". It indicates adherence to specific guidelines or requirements.
How can I use "as per the specification" in a sentence?
You can use "as per the specification" to indicate that something is done in accordance with a documented set of instructions or guidelines. For example: "The software was developed "according to the specification" provided by the client."
What are some alternatives to "as per the specification"?
Alternatives include "according to the specification", "in accordance with the specification", or "following the specification".
Is it more appropriate to say "as per the specifications" or "as per the specification"?
Use "as per the specification" when referring to a single, specific document. Use "as per the specifications" when referring to multiple or general specifications. For example: "The product was built as per the specification document" versus "The product was built as per industry specifications".
